Hudson Bayou is a tranquil, sought-after neighborhood where in-town convenience meets waterfront living — winding, mangrove-lined bayou frontage just south of downtown, with a mix of updated older homes and refined new custom builds. Many residences have docks and water views, and owners want treatments that frame the serene bayou setting while handling the bright, reflected light off the water.
We design for that waterfront calm: solar shades and soft sheers that preserve the view and cut glare, layered with drapery or shutters for privacy on close in-town lots. Salt-tolerant hardware and moisture-friendly materials keep everything performing beautifully near the water, all specified in your home against its exposure.

The light, views, and architecture here shape every recommendation we make. Here is what we plan for in Hudson Bayou.
Light reflects off the water into main living spaces. Solar shades and sheers cut the glare while keeping the tranquil bayou view.
Homes sit on close lots near downtown. Layered drapery and shutters add privacy from the street while the water side stays open.
Bayou-front humidity and salt air call for corrosion-resistant hardware and moisture-friendly materials that last.
